A hot cup of pumpkin spice latte might not hit the spot right now because it's so dang blastin' hot, but if you're craving it it won't be long before you can get that grande PSL from Starbucks.

According to the calendar, fall begins September 23rd and it appears as if your favorite coffee drink will return before fall debuts. According to many predictions, the popular drink could be back in the coffee retailer as soon as August 28th. Yes, before fall and it will still be blastin' hot outside, but that won't stop the dedicated to getting that cup of PSL!

Reddit feeds are showing pics of pumpkin spice flavored sauce being stocked on backroom shelves in Starbucks stores around the natino. According to
Business Insider, the date of August 28th isn't that far off from past six years when pumpkin spice latte premieres. The earliest was back in 2014 on August 26th and then as late as September 4th in 2015. In either case, if history holds true, you'll be able to wrap your hands around that warm cup of pumpkin spice latte from Starbucks in less than a month.
